First, recognize that while Lost Hills itself is a small community, your search for a home loan company will likely extend to nearby hubs. Lenders based in Bakersfield, Delano, or even those offering robust online services statewide are common resources. The key is finding one familiar with Kern County's property types and values. A lender who knows the area can provide more accurate appraisals and understand the nuances of buying in a rural, agriculturally-focused community. They can also advise on properties that may have well water or septic systems, which are common here and can sometimes require additional inspections or considerations for loan approval.
For Lost Hills homebuyers, exploring California-specific homebuyer programs should be a top priority. The California Housing Finance Agency (CalHFA) offers several programs with competitive interest rates and down payment assistance for first-time buyers, which can be a game-changer. Given that "first-time buyer" is defined as not having owned a home in the last three years, many residents may qualify. Additionally, there are specialized programs for teachers, police officers, firefighters, and veterans that can provide further advantages. A knowledgeable local loan officer can help you determine your eligibility for these valuable state resources.
Your actionable first step is to get pre-approved, not just pre-qualified. Pre-approval carries much more weight with sellers and gives you a clear budget, crucial in any market. When interviewing potential lenders, ask direct questions: "Do you frequently work with buyers in Kern County's unincorporated areas?" "Can you explain how CalHFA programs work with your loan products?" "What is your typical timeline for closing a loan in this region?" Their answers will reveal their local expertise.
